Poverty Rate in Sunflower, Mississippi

  • In Sunflower, Mississippi, an estimated 640 of 1,141 people live in poverty.

FAQs

  • What is the poverty rate in Sunflower, Mississippi?

    The poverty rate in Sunflower, Mississippi is 56.1%.

  • How many people in Sunflower, Mississippi live in poverty?

    In Sunflower, Mississippi, an estimated 640 of 1,141 people live in poverty.

  • How does the poverty rate in Sunflower, Mississippi compare to the average for Mississippi?

    The poverty rate in Sunflower, Mississippi is 189.18% higher than the Mississippi average. In Sunflower, Mississippi, an estimated 56.1% of 1,141 people live in poverty. In Mississippi, 19.4% of 2,861,627 people live in poverty.

  • How does the poverty rate in Sunflower, Mississippi compare to the US?

    The poverty rate in Sunflower, Mississippi is 338.28% higher than the US average. In Sunflower, Mississippi, an estimated 56.1% of 1,141 people live in poverty. In the United States, 12.8% of 324,173,084 people live in poverty.
